Tomson hangings have a gentle personality and are very beautiful in appearance. They do not have high requirements for water quality and food. It is recommended that the water temperature for raising Tomson hangings should not be lower than 30℃, and the pH value is 8.1-8.4. Keeping Tomson hangings requires an activity space of no less than 350 liters of water, as well as the creation of various caves for hiding.

Tomson hangings mainly feed on zooplankton, crustaceans and fish eggs. Seaweed, vegetables, frozen fish and shrimp meat, invertebrates, and high-quality plant-based marine fish feed containing seaweed can also be prepared. It is recommended to feed 3 times a day.
